Description

Usability bugs - not showstoppers but could use some polishing.

  • no handling or warning if you subscribe a user without an email.
  • No way to skip the confirm your subscription?
  • Download the log file displays a blank page in the browser - temp/public/newsletter-log-2.txt
  • adding a subscriber, selecting a user but checking "Add Email" crashes Tiki. (unhandled null)
  • no way to filter or recognize anonymous spam bots
